#2bb054 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2bb054 is composed of 16.9% red, 69%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 52.3%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 138.5 degrees, a saturation of 60.7% and a lightness of 42.9%. #2bb054 color hex could be obtained by blending #56ffa8 with #006100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#2bb054 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2bb054 has RGB values of R:43, G:176,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:0, Y:0.52,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 2863188.
